KABUL, Afghanistan — Afghan national army and International Security Assistance Force soldiers in the Pech District, Kunar province, killed two senior insurgents and captured four others yesterday, July 15.

Two of the detained individuals are known insurgents, and were involved in improvised explosive device attacks throughout the Pech area.

Insurgents who place IEDs are responsible for the indiscriminate killing and injuring of security forces and innocent Afghan civilians.

The removal of these insurgents will lead to improved safety and security for local Afghans.
